Serbia suffered two consecutive mass shootings on May 3 and May 4, leaving the country rattled. Psychologists are wondering whether the attacks come as a result of the normalization of violence on popular Serbian television shows and social media networks. KCSB’s Jennifer Zwigl discusses the details.…

The presidents of Kosovo and Serbia both accused each other of stoking tensions in Kosovo at a European Union summit on June 1. Kosovo's President Vjosa Osmani blamed "criminal gangs" for recent clashes, while her Serbian counterpart, Aleksandar Vucic, called for the annulment of recent elections.Originally published at - https://www.rferl.org/a/ko…

Ethnic Serbs unfurled a large Serbian flag during a protest on May 31 in the town of Zvecan in northern Kosovo, where violent clashes earlier in the week reportedly left some 30 NATO peacekeepers with injuries. In response, NATO said it would send 700 additional soldiers to Kosovo. Originally published at - https://www.rferl.org/a/kosovo-serbia-pro…

Amid a new wave of Russian drone attacks on Ukraine, analysts in Kyiv are gaining useful intelligence from downed Russian aerial weapons. They study the remains of Iranian Shahed drones and Russian Kinzhal missiles, among others. Ukrainians are finding ways to intercept some hypersonic missiles.Originally published at - https://www.rferl.org/a/ukra…
